Introduction to REF3325AIDBZR

The REF3325AIDBZR is a precision voltage reference device, often used in sensitive applications where accuracy and stability are crucial. As a vital component in electronic systems, it is essential to understand how to troubleshoot and prevent any failures that might arise, ensuring the device performs reliably in a range of environments.

Common Causes of REF3325AIDBZR Failures

Before jumping into the solutions, it's crucial to understand the root causes of REF3325AIDBZR failures. By diagnosing these issues, you can prevent them from occurring in the first place, or at least identify them early enough to avoid severe damage.

Overvoltage or Undervoltage Conditions:

One of the most common causes of REF3325AIDBZR failure is operating the device outside its recommended voltage range. Overvoltage can cause internal components to overheat or become damaged, while undervoltage can lead to inaccurate readings or the failure to Power up altogether. Always ensure that the device is connected within its specified voltage range for optimal performance.

Incorrect Load Conditions:

The REF3325AIDBZR is designed to handle specific load conditions, and exceeding these limits can cause malfunction or failure. If the load connected to the device draws more current than the reference can supply, it will cause the voltage reference to fail or degrade in performance.

Temperature Fluctuations:

Excessive temperature changes, especially in high-temperature environments, can lead to a breakdown in the stability of the REF3325AIDBZR. Extreme temperatures may affect the internal components and lead to malfunctioning or complete failure.

Electrostatic Discharge (ESD):

Electrostatic discharge is another major culprit when it comes to failures in sensitive electronic components. Handling the REF3325AIDBZR without proper precautions can lead to ESD damage, which may not show immediate signs of failure but can reduce the lifespan and reliability of the device.

Troubleshooting Techniques for REF3325AIDBZR Failures

Once you’ve identified potential symptoms or causes of failure, the next step is troubleshooting. The following techniques can help diagnose and fix common issues with the REF3325AIDBZR:

Check the Input Power Source:

One of the first things to check when troubleshooting is the input power supply. Measure the input voltage to confirm that it lies within the specified range for the REF3325AIDBZR. Overvoltage or undervoltage can easily cause failure or degradation of performance. If the voltage is outside the allowed limits, adjust the power source to match the recommended specifications.

Measure the Output Voltage:

Using a multimeter or oscilloscope, measure the output voltage of the REF3325AIDBZR. The voltage should remain stable and within the tolerance range specified in the datasheet. Any significant deviation may indicate internal failure or problems related to the reference’s circuitry. In such cases, it may be necessary to replace the component or recalibrate the system.

Inspect for Overheating:

Check if the device is running excessively hot. If it is, this could be a sign that there is an issue with the internal components, or the device may not be dissipating heat properly. Proper cooling techniques or even switching to a different power source may be necessary.

Verify Load Conditions:

Ensure that the load connected to the REF3325AIDBZR is within acceptable limits. If the device is being subjected to excessive load or incorrect current demands, it could lead to failure. Reducing the load or using a load resistor may help in stabilizing the voltage reference.

Examine for ESD Damage:

ESD is a serious threat to sensitive electronic components like the REF3325AIDBZR. If you suspect ESD damage, consider checking the component under a microscope for any signs of burnt marks or physical damage. Additionally, ensure that all handling precautions are followed in the future to prevent static discharge.

Preventive Measures to Avoid REF3325AIDBZR Failures

Prevention is always better than cure, especially when dealing with crucial electronic components. Here are some preventive measures to protect your REF3325AIDBZR from failures:

Use Surge Protection:

Incorporating surge protection into your system can prevent voltage spikes that could damage the REF3325AIDBZR. By using surge protection devices, you minimize the risk of overvoltage and extend the life of your voltage reference.

Implement Proper Grounding:

A well-grounded system ensures that the REF3325AIDBZR operates within its intended parameters. Grounding helps to reduce noise, prevent ESD, and improve the overall stability of your electronics.

Thermal Management :

Effective heat dissipation techniques are crucial to prevent overheating. Using heat sinks, thermal vias, or proper ventilation helps to maintain a stable temperature environment for the REF3325AIDBZR.

Regular Calibration:

Periodically calibrating your REF3325AIDBZR ensures that it maintains accurate performance over time. Calibration can help detect early signs of drift in the output voltage and allow for timely corrective action.
